Hi Guys,
I've just turned on a Qube3 after relocating it and AppleTalk services
appear to be missing. I've found the following in messages;
Jun 6 21:27:47 qube papd[1427]: restart (1.4b2+asun2.1.4)
Jun 6 21:27:48 qube kernel: eth0: speed=100 duplex=full link=up
Jun 6 21:27:55 qube papd[1427]: can't register Lexmark:LaserWriter@*
Jun 6 21:27:57 qube afpd[1436]: Can't register qube:AFPServer@*
Jun 6 21:27:57 qube afpd[1436]: ASIP started on 192.168.100.36:548(0)
(1.4b2+asun2.1.4)
Jun 6 21:27:58 qube afpd[1436]: uam: uams_clrtxt.so loaded
Jun 6 21:27:58 qube afpd[1436]: uam: uams_dhx.so loaded
Jun 6 21:27:58 qube afpd[1436]: uam: "DHCAST128" available
Jun 6 21:27:58 qube afpd[1436]: uam: "Cleartxt Passwrd" available
I guess the failure to register the Lexmark print queue and the qube as an
Appleshare server are the reason for not seeing them in Chooser.
The question is why can't these services register?
